The Math of Dilution (1:4 to 1:32)

Understanding Dilution Ratios

Dilution ratios express the concentration of cleaning agents in a solution. A 1:4 dilution ratio means one part cleaner to four parts water, while a 1:32 ratio means one part cleaner to 32 parts water. This mathematical relationship is vital for achieving optimal cleaning performance without wasting valuable product.

To determine the correct volume of cleaner needed, one must take precise fluid ounce tracking into account. For instance, if a cleaner is to be diluted at a 1:4 ratio and you require 20 fluid ounces of the solution, you’d divide that by 5 (1 part cleaner + 4 parts water), amounting to 4 fluid ounces of concentrated cleaner and 16 fluid ounces of water. In a commercial setting, utilizing a chemical dilution chart becomes invaluable, as it allows for quick reference and minimizes human error. It simplifies the mixing process, ensuring cleaning staff can concentrate on the task without the ambiguity of calculations.

Automated Dispensing Systems vs Manual Measuring

Automated Dispensing Systems vs Manual Measuring in Bulk All Purpose Liquid Cleaner Preparation

Automated Dispensing Systems: Precision at Your Fingertips

Automated dispensing systems are designed to streamline the mixing of cleaning chemicals, ensuring precision in fluid ounce tracking. These systems often employ wall-mounted chemical proportioners that dispense exact amounts of concentrate and water, resulting in a perfectly balanced solution every time. This level of accuracy not only enhances cleaning effectiveness but also significantly reduces the risk of over-concentration, which can lead to chemical waste and potential safety hazards.

One of the most significant advantages of automated systems is their ability to maintain consistency across batches. In environments where multiple staff members are involved in the cleaning process, variations in measurement can lead to inconsistent results. Automated systems mitigate this risk by offering pre-set mixing ratios as per the chemical dilution chart, ensuring that each gallon of cleaner meets the same high standards of efficacy.

Commercial budget calculations benefit from the implementation of automated dispensing systems as well. While the initial investment in these systems may be higher compared to manual measuring tools, the long-term savings due to reduced chemical wastage and the improved lifecycle of equipment make them a financially sound decision. Businesses can track their cleaning costs more effectively, understanding precisely how much they spend per gallon and allowing for better budget forecasting.

Moreover, automated systems can also touch on the aspect of chemical stability timelines. Many cleaning concentrates have a limited shelf life once diluted. Automated systems minimize the waste of mixed solutions by allowing users to mix only what they need for immediate use, thereby contributing to better chemical management.

Manual Measuring: The Traditional Approach

On the other side of the spectrum, manual measuring remains a popular choice for many smaller operations or settings where budgets do not allow for the investment in automated systems. This method involves using measuring cups or graduated cylinders to mix concentrated cleaners with water, often relying on the worker’s skill and experience to achieve the right dilution rate.

While manual measuring may appear to offer greater flexibility, it comes with a notable trade-off in terms of accuracy. Each worker may interpret "one part cleaner to four parts water" differently, leading to significant inconsistencies—particularly in high-volume settings. This variance can detract from cleaning efficacy and result in increased use of chemicals, ultimately raising the cost per gallon of cleaning.

Moreover, manual measuring can lead to safety concerns. In environments that require stringent adherence to safety protocols, improper mixing can lead to dangerous chemical reactions or compromise the stability of the cleaning solution. Depending on the type and concentration of the chemicals being used, incorrect dilution can even pose health risks to employees, making it essential for facilities to prioritize safety.

Bulk storage safety is also a consideration here. When using a manual measuring approach, the risk of accidents can rise if chemicals are not stored appropriately and handled by multiple users. Having designated measuring tools can help, but the human factor in handling and mixing remains a risk that automated systems can largely eliminate.
